Personality: Wanda Maximoff is a very dynamic character. She carries doubt and guilt over the mistakes she's made but she has a deep desire to set things right.
She is very passionate, a little idealistic and tries to do what is right despite what others think. She likes to fight directly and doesn't consider herself the type to give up. When she chooses to accept Tony's house arrest, she considered it another option to keeping people safe. This is also why her decision to go with Clint appeared sudden. It wasn't sudden, he showed her that there was another way to handle the situation that she wasn't seeing. Clint has talked Wanda out of inaction twice in her life and during both situations it was when she couldn't see another way.
She has a lot of hope and a rare type of innocence that hasn't been taken from her. Despite the seriousness of Wanda's working attitude she likes to tease her friends and simple things make her smile. She loves her friends and will be there to support them no matter what. Those she's closest too are Steve and the people she spent most of her time training with.
She plays the guitar to help her think and holds her memories, specifically of her brother and her parents, close to her heart. She has a very caring nature and is able to do a lot due to her devotion to others, first her brother and then the avengers. These are her greatest motivations but can also be the cause for her anger. She gets angry at anyone she considers her enemy and can be ruthless and almost cruel when her heart is broken. Best case of this was with Ultron after her brother was killed. Wanda can be vengeful towards others which implies that she holds grudges as well.
Her powers are feared by the mass populace and she feels helpless against the rising views against her. She blames herself for being unable to save the people that she'd been trying to protect and carries the weight of each death that she considers her fault. This is best shown in the compound when Steve comes to talk to her. She wasn't in trouble or punished and yet she was staying to her room like she was grounded. She is hard on herself and while Steve tries to cheer her up he only half succeeds.
Even with her good intentions it takes Wanda some time to open up to others. At first she was only close to Pietro and his death has made it harder for her to open up to others. Despite her difficulty when opening up to others Wanda is easy to read and open with her emotions. It was her intense emotions that got her through the testing and experiments at Hydra and they continue to thrive and define her.
She's courageous and selfless and will put her personal grudges aside if it means working towards the greater good. She doesn't want to hurt people who've done nothing wrong. Living with Tony and fighting Ultron has opened up her world to the gray areas of life. When it was her and her brother the world was very black and white for Wanda; us verse them. Now she's able to see that not everyone is evil just because they're on another side. Everyone is fighting to protect something.
She's smart and notices parts about people that they sometimes don't mean to give away. She's the one who first pulls her and her brother away from Ultron's crazy plan and seeks to help the Avengers. She's quick to follow how she feels and act on that feeling be it lashing out or closing in on herself. She has the ability to be very empathetic.
